[jQuery] jQuery empty 메소드를 이용한 메뉴 초기화
jQuery를 사용하여 동적인 메뉴를 개발할 때, 메뉴 내용을 업데이트하거나 초기화해야 하는 경우가 있습니다. jQuery의 empty
메소드는 이를 쉽게 처리할 수 있도록 도와줍니다. 이 기사에서는 empty
메소드를 사용하여 메뉴를 초기화하는 방법에 대해 알아보겠습니다.
menu-container 요소 초기화
가장 먼저 초기화할 메뉴를 감싸는 부모 요소를 식별해야 합니다. 이 예제에서는 #menu-container
를 사용하겠습니다.
$("#menu-container").empty();
위의 코드에서는 empty
메소드를 사용하여 #menu-container
내부의 모든 자식 요소를 삭제합니다.
메뉴 초기화 예제
실제 예제를 통해 empty
메소드를 사용하여 메뉴를 초기화하는 방법을 살펴보겠습니다. 아래는 간단한 메뉴를 초기화하는 예제 코드입니다.
<!DOCTYPE html>
<html lang="ko">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>메뉴 초기화 예제</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script>
$(document).ready(function(){
$("#reset-menu-btn").click(function(){
$("#menu-container").empty();
});
});
</script>
</head>
<body>
<div id="menu-container">
<ul>
<li>메뉴 항목 1</li>
<li>메뉴 항목 2</li>
<li>메뉴 항목 3</li>
</ul>
</div>
<button id="reset-menu-btn">메뉴 초기화</button>
</body>
</html>
위의 예제는 #reset-menu-btn
을 클릭하면 #menu-container
내의 모든 자식 요소가 삭제됩니다.
이러한 방식으로 empty
메소드를 활용하여 jQuery를 사용하여 동적 메뉴를 쉽게 초기화할 수 있습니다. 이를 통해 메뉴를 업데이트하거나 재구성할 때 편리하게 사용할 수 있습니다.
결론
jQuery의 empty
메소드를 사용하면 메뉴를 초기화하는 작업을 간단히 수행할 수 있습니다. 이를 통해 동적인 웹 애플리케이션을 개발할 때 유용하게 활용할 수 있습니다.
작성자: 니나 리, 개발자